The temporal lobe is a region of the brain located beneath the lateral fissure on both hemispheres, primarily responsible for processing auditory information, language comprehension, memory, and emotion. It plays a crucial role in various cognitive functions and is composed of several substructures, including the hippocampus, amygdala, and auditory cortex.
Functions of the Temporal Lobe:
Auditory Processing: The temporal lobe houses the primary auditory cortex, where auditory signals from the ears are processed and interpreted. It enables individuals to perceive and understand sounds, including speech and music.
Language Comprehension: The left temporal lobe, particularly the posterior portion known as Wernicke's area, is essential for language comprehension. It helps individuals understand spoken and written language, decode linguistic symbols, and extract meaning from verbal communication.
Memory Formation: The hippocampus, located within the temporal lobe, is critical for the formation and consolidation of declarative memories, including episodic memories (personal experiences) and semantic memories (general knowledge).
Emotion Regulation: The temporal lobe, particularly the amygdala, is involved in processing emotional stimuli and regulating emotional responses. It plays a role in fear, aggression, reward processing, and social behavior.
Damage or dysfunction of the temporal lobe can result in various neurological and psychological impairments, including auditory processing deficits, language disorders (such as aphasia), memory problems (such as amnesia), and emotional disturbances (such as anxiety or depression). Understanding the functions of the temporal lobe is essential for elucidating its role in cognition, behavior, and emotion, as well as diagnosing and treating neurological and psychiatric disorders.
